Protein Function mitosis-accelerating kinase plays as an activator of cell contractility and MRTF-A/SRF (myocardin-related transcription factor A/serum response factor) signaling.
Biochemical Properties promotes normal G2-mitosis transition by inhibiting PP2A via ARPP19 and ENSA.Constitutively active MASTL promoted dephosphorylation of CDK1(Tyr15) and accelerated mitotic entry after DNA damage.

Significance of PTMs Phosphorylated(Phosphorylation at Thr-745,Ser875,Thr194, Thr207, S213 and Thr741 by CDK1) and auto-phosphorylation on Ser875 during mitosis entry,which is essential for its activity.during mitosis exit again dephosphorylated by PP1 phosphatase.Deactivation of MASTL is essential for mitotic exit.
